Dan Gilbert's Bedrock Gets $1-Million State Loan for Capitol Park Project

Dan Gilbert's Bedrock Real Estate Services has received approval for $1 million in state loan to convert a vacant Capitol Park building in downtown Detroit into 5,500 square feet of first-floor retail space and 25 residential units, Crain's Detroit Business reports.

The project at 1215 Griswold St. is expected to create create 16 jobs, the Gilbert folks say in a memo to the Michigan Strategic Fund board, which approved the Michigan Community Revitalization Program  performance-based loan announced Wednesday.

It's Bedrock's first support from the Michigan Strategic Fund.
